LG Mountain Festival: City Rail Jam

In conjunction with the LG FIS World Cup Park Royal South hosted the LG Mountain Festival on their rooftop parking, complete with sponsor booths, bikini and lingerie shows and of course snowboarding with the City Rail Jam. As with most rail jams there always seems to be a few guys who you wonder how they even got into the event as you cringe upon their ride up and usually flail or catch down the rail but there were for sure some stand out rail riders like Jed Anderson, Harrison Grey, and Cory Gallon. For the ladies only 3 were given the opportunity to compete, Molly Milligan, Jess Kimura, and Breanna Strangeland.  After all the slush settled Jed Anderson and Jess Kimura emerged triumphant.

CITY RAIL RESULTS:
MEN
    1.    JED ANDERSON
    2.    JESMOND DUBEAU
    3.    CORY GALLON
WOMEN
    1.    JESS KIMURA
    2.    BREANNA STRANGELAND

The Inaugural Burton Canadian Open Premiered this weekend in Calgary at Canada Olympic Park.  An international field of competitors went up against a good mix of local talent in both the pipe and slopestyle events. With awesome weather, sun, and a perfect pipe and slopestyle course I witnessed some of the best competition riding for both male and female riders this year.  Good times were had riding, hanging and chilling at the event all week.  Every event and finals was impressive but the female slopestyle finals blew me away. Girls were stomping 720’s, Cab 540’s, switch B/S 540’s, combo rail tricks it was very impressive!

Catboarding with Simon

Between my travels to Idaho with ThirtyTwo, Aspen for X-Games and SIA in Vegas I managed to fit in a day of  Catboarding at Powder Mountain with Simon Chamberlain, his brothers Andre and Matt and ThirtyTwo/Stepchild Am Joe Sexton all to be filmed by the Fuel TV Crew for Simon's upcoming First Hand.  The clouds hung low and the visibility was pretty minimal at first but as the morning progressed pockets of sun began to emerge and we could actually see and enjoy all the fresh powder! Although there was a lot of set up and stop and go for the filming it was an epic day with friends and cool to see how tight Simon is with his brothers and teammate.  Thanks Jory and Jeff for letting me tag along and thanks Powder Mountain for having amazing terrain and great guides Nick and Shaymus. Look for Simon's First Hand to air on Fuel TV in March 2009.
